WebFeb 11, 2024 · For fixed-term tenancies signed after 11 February 2024 for longer than 90 days, at the end of this period the tenancy automatically becomes a periodic tenancy. You and your landlord can agree to renew the fixed term instead. The agreement needs to be in writing and signed by both parties. WebA fixed-term tenancy of 90 days (three months) or less finishes on the end date that’s specified in the agreement. A fixed-term tenancy of more than 90 days automatically continues as a new indefinite (periodic) tenancy after the end date of the fixed term, unless: you and the landlord enter into a new agreement or extend the existing one, or

WebTo end a periodic tenancy, you must give notice of at least 28′ days and it has to be in writing (email, or post). The written notice must contain the address it relates to, the date you wish to end the tenancy, and be signed by all the tenants listed on the tenancy agreement. WebThe tenant must: move out by the date set out in the notice ending the tenancy, leave the property reasonably clean and tidy, remove any rubbish or arrange for its removal, and; pay the rent up to the last day of the tenancy. WebMar 12, 2024 · A landlord needs to be providing at least 60 days’ written notice if they are increasing rent. They also can’t be increasing the rent in the first 180 days of the tenancy, and in the 180 days after the last rent increase.
